# Djeru and Hazoret
- **Mana Cost:** `{2}{R}{R}{W}` (CMC: 5)
- **Type:** Legendary Creature — Human God

## Oracle Text
As long as you have one or fewer cards in hand, Djeru and Hazoret has vigilance and haste.
Whenever Djeru and Hazoret attacks, look at the top six cards of your library. You may exile a legendary creature card from among them. Put the rest on the bottom of your library in a random order. Until end of turn, you may cast the exiled card without paying its mana cost.

## Official Rulings
- *(2023-04-14)* If you cast a spell without paying its mana cost, you can’t choose to cast it for any alternative costs. You can, however, pay any additional costs. If the spell has any mandatory additional costs, you must pay those.
- *(2023-04-14)* If the spell has {X} in its mana cost, you must choose 0 as the value of X when casting it without paying its mana cost.
- *(2023-04-14)* Once Djeru and Hazoret has legally attacked during the turn it came under your control, causing it to lose haste by adding cards to your hand won’t cause it to stop attacking. Similarly, causing it to lose vigilance after it has attacked won’t cause it to become tapped.
